Politicians, Celebs At Detroit Woman’s Convention

Actress Rose McGowan will help open a 3-day National Women’s Convention at Detroit’s Cobo Center. McGowan was one of the first to accuse producer Harvey Weinstein of sexual assaults.
The weekend meeting has a political bent, with activists and part of the agenda which says ‘resist Trump.’

As many as 5-thousand women from around the world are expected in town for the event.

It was organized by the Women’s March, the same activist group that led massive rallies around the world back on January 21st, the day following the inauguration of President Trump.

It’s purpose, according to organizers, was to send the message that women’s rights are human rights.

Several high-profile names are scheduled to speak at the convention.

Tonight’s keynote speaker will be U-S Senator Bernie Sanders.

He is expected to outline how the women’s movement can move forward in achieving its goals.
